目的:探讨细胞周期调控相关蛋白p53、p21、信号转导子和转录活化因子3(signal transducers and activators of transcription 3,STAT3)和细胞周期蛋白1(Cyclin D1)的表达在异常黑胆质型肝癌病证动物模型肝硬化期的发生发展中的作用.方法:根据维吾尔医学理论,在异常黑胆质载体大鼠模型的基础上,用二乙基亚硝胺(diethylnirtosamine)诱发建立维吾尔医异常黑胆质型肝癌病证模型肝脏标本用免疫组织化学法检测p53、p21、STAT3和Cyclin D1等基因的表达水平.结果:p53、p21、STAT3和Cyclin D1等基因的表达水平与对照组相比,对照肝癌组和异常黑胆质型肝癌病证组均上调,差异具有统计学意义(P<0.01);与对照肝癌组相比异常黑胆质型肝癌病证组上调,差异具有统计学意义(P<0.05).结论:异常黑胆质体液可能通过上调p53、p21、STAT3和Cyclin D1等基因的表达水平影响细胞周期调控,从而促进异常黑胆质型肝癌病证模型肝硬化的发生和发展.
